13 CATs should be more than enough.

The GMATPrep practice tests (free from https://www.mba.com/the-gmat/download-fr ... tware.aspx) will provide the most accurate scores with they use official GMAT questions and the official GMAT scoring algorithm.

Also keep in mind that you can take the GMATPrep tests multiple times. Yes, you will see some repeated questions, but not that many. If you're interested, I wrote an article for BTG on this topic: https://www.beatthegmat.com/mba/2010/03/ ... iple-times
